Meat Processing Facility to Open in Virginia

LYNCHBURG, Va. (AP) — Virginia Gov. Terry McAuliffe says a meat processing facility will open in Lynchburg, creating 43 new jobs.

McAuliffe says Seven Hills Food, LLC will invest $3 million and commit to purchasing Virginia-grown beef and pork.

Seven Hills Food will invest in the building improvements and equipment needed to renovate the former Dinner Bell Meat processing facility in Lynchburg. Once finished, the facility will be one of the largest beef and pork processing operations in Virginia.

The company intends to purchase 12,000 Virginia cattle and hogs over the next three years. The Virginia cattle, calf, and hog industries generate almost half-billion dollars alone in farm cash receipts.
